Key Providers of Import and Export Data in India

1. Customs Department of India

The Customs Department of India is the primary source of import and export data in the country. It maintains detailed records of all goods entering and leaving Indian territory. This data is categorized by product type, quantity, value, origin, and destination, providing a comprehensive overview of trade activities.

2. Indian Trade Portal

The Indian Trade Portal is a valuable online platform that offers a wide range of trade-related information, including import and export statistics. It provides access to a user-friendly database that allows businesses to search for specific products, view tariff rates, and analyze trade trends.

3. Commercial Market Research Firms

Several commercial market research firms specialize in collecting, analyzing, and presenting import and export data. These firms often provide additional services such as market research reports, competitor analysis, and industry insights, making them a valuable resource for businesses seeking in-depth market intelligence.

Leveraging Import and Export Data for Business Success

1. Market Entry Strategies

By analyzing import and export data, businesses can identify lucrative markets with high demand for their products. This information can guide decisions regarding market entry strategies, such as establishing partnerships, setting up distribution channels, or even direct market entry.

2. Product Customization and Innovation

Understanding consumer preferences in different markets is essential for product customization and innovation. Import and export data can reveal which product features are most valued by consumers in specific regions, enabling businesses to tailor their offerings for maximum appeal.

3. Supply Chain Optimization

Efficient supply chain management is critical for minimizing costs and maximizing profitability. Import and export data can provide insights into the most efficient shipping routes, optimal inventory levels, and potential bottlenecks in the supply chain.
